Would-Be Burglar Pries Window on Limberlost Lane, Police Said
Cops made two public-intoxication arrests in Bryn Mawr and Rosemont last week, too.
The following police incidents happened in the Bryn Mawr-Gladwyne area in the past week, Lower Merion police told news media Monday afternoon:
Attempted burglary: A resident of the 1200 block of Limberlost Lane in Gladwyne reported to police that the exterior of a dining room window had been damaged by someone attempting to pry open the window between Jan. 23 and Jan. 30.
Public intoxication: A 21-year-old Rosemont College student tried to enter a private home he mistakenly thought was his college room about 3 a.m. Jan. 29, police said. A resident of the 1200 block of Wendover Road in Rosemont called police to report a man knocked at her door asking to come in before walking away. Police stopped the man soon afterward and charged him with public intoxication; the man's blood alcohol content tested at 0.18.

Public intoxication: A 22-year-old Philadelphia man was cited on the first block of North Roberts Road about 12:45 a.m. Feb. 1.
Marijuana possession, disorderly conduct, expired registration: A 51-year-old New Hope man was charged about 7:35 a.m. Feb. 1 at Lancaster and Merion avenues after being pulled over for running a red light, police said.
